Quote:
Originally Posted by Dawn
I like this gig , I agree they do seem tired. On cRUSH dvd is there also making of the crush tour ????? Where Jon drives round NJ ????

Ive got making of the crush tour copied but the quality isnt great would like to have it clearer, can u let me know if its included on Crush DVD.

Dawn
No Dawn, the making of the Crush tour where Jon goes to some of his old haunts in NJ is NOT on the dvd. It was on Real Player for quite some time but was never released on dvd. I for one would love to have that piece as well.

When did you all get so positive about this DVD? I like it for the Crush songs...but other than that.....meh.

The overall performance is noticably on auto pilot. The sound quality is muddy. I consider One Last Wild Night as being a step up from this...though the sound on that is utter crap compared to the Crush Tour.

As for a HAND tour DVD....I'll be surprised if it happens. Demand for something doesn't neccessarily result in anything. We all wanted a live VHS for the Jersey Syndicate tour....that never happened, we got a documentary instead. woo hoo. We wanted a live video with the box set. We got clips of the aforementioned documentary recycled and Jon talkin in the studio about the songs on the set. whee.
